It isn’t always about cars. Electric cars, buses, and trucks make big news. They’re big things with big prices, so they are big industries. But, notice the number of ebikes humming along. In Bloomberg’s annual electric vehicle report, 2/3 of the oil savings are from ebikes and their ilk. (trucks ~2%, buses ~14%, cars ~ 18%, 2&3 wheelers ~67%) This may just be a duh moment as we experience it; but, maybe people are finding out that they don’t need to pay tens of thousands of dollars to own and operate a multi-ton vehicle to go to the store. The change to electric vehicles may be more significant than replacing gas cars with electric cars and more about replacing cars with something more practical. Besides, finding ways around traffic, parking, and storage can be appealing too. Those benefits were there before, but they are benefiting from electrification.
